A massive, shadowy conglomerate of organizations led by the enigmatic "Big Man," aiming to reshape the world order through economic and magical dominance.
Player-Facing Lore
- Leadership: Led by Araqiel Zoval, often referred to as "The Big Man." He is a charismatic revolutionary with an agenda to "Reforge, Reform, and Reeducate."
- Identity & Symbology:
- The Amulet: Members and operatives often carry a Lead Amulet etched with the guild's symbol.
- The Motto: "Reforge, Reform, and Reeducate."
- Smiling Snake: The Zevnori subfaction uses a distinct smiling snake insignia.
- Structure: The Guild Halls act as an umbrella organization, controlling or influencing several powerful factions:
- Reaper's Kiss (Assassins)
- Druids of the Twilight Moon (Lycans)
- Dusk Watchers (Magitech Research)
- Zevnori (Spies and Secret Police, known by their smiling snake symbol)
- Merchant's Guild (Economic Arm, including figures like the Count of Weymouth)
- Public Services: The organization runs an extensive banking service, offering loans to patrons. "Hallmarked" individuals (members) receive preferential rates and higher borrowing limits.
- Goal: To overthrow the Gods and end their influence on the Material Plane, believing that mortals should rule themselves. They seek to restore the blade Encriadine to accomplish this.
- Base of Operations: A floating city in the Astral Plane, hidden within an asteroid field charged with psionic storms. It is accessible via a portal in a demiplane known as "The Gauntlet" in La Bastille.
